Pulmonary hypertension (PH) is a common and widely misunderstood syndrome that results from a surprisingly large number of disease processes. It can occur at any age and the risk of developing PH increases with age and other medical conditions. Great strides have been made in the past 15 years in diagnosing and treating p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H) so that the natural history of PAH is rapidly changing.
